How It Differs from Free Play or Demo Casinos
A real-money online casino fundamentally differs from free play or demo casinos by requiring actual financial risk. In free play, credits are replenished indefinitely, removing the psychological weight of loss. Real-money play introduces the tangible possibility of losing personal funds, which alters decision-making: players often employ stricter bankroll management and exit strategies absent in demo modes. The stakes-driven engagement also changes game dynamics, as payout percentages and volatility directly affect real balances. Free versions cannot replicate the adrenaline or caution tied to real deposits.
- Demo casinos use virtual chips with no withdrawal potential; real-money casinos convert winnings into cash payouts.
- Free play allows unlimited retries; real-money play imposes financial limits, forcing strategic betting.
- Real-money platforms enforce identity verification for withdrawals; demo modes require no personal data.
- Only real-money play triggers loyalty rewards or cashback tied to actual deposits and losses.
The Core Mechanics Behind Wagering and Payouts
Real-money online casino wagering hinges on the **Return to Player (RTP)** percentage and the Random Number Generator (RNG). Your stake enters a digital pool where the RNG ensures each spin or card draw is independent and unpredictable. Payouts are then calculated by multiplying your wager by the game’s designated odds. For slot-based mechanics, a payline’s hit frequency dictates how often you recover funds, while progressive jackpots pool a fraction of every bet into a single, explosive prize. Understanding that the house edge is mathematically embedded into every transaction—not manipulated per session—lets you manage bankroll expectations with precision.

Setting Deposit Limits and Choosing Stakes
Setting deposit limits and choosing stakes form the operational core of bankroll control. First, establish a daily, weekly, or monthly deposit cap through the casino’s responsible gaming settings; this prevents impulsive top-ups after losses. Next, calculate your per-session unit size by dividing your total bankroll into at least 50-100 equal parts. Each wager should never exceed one unit.
- Determine your total monthly gambling budget.
- Set a deposit limit at 50% of that budget.
- Divide the limit by 20 betting sessions to get your maximum per-session stake.

How Do House Edge and RTP Affect My Chances?
The house edge and RTP directly define your odds of winning real cash. The house edge represents the casino’s built-in advantage on every bet, while RTP (Return to Player) shows the theoretical percentage wagered money returned to players over time. A lower house edge—like 0.5% on blackjack—means you lose less per spin or hand, preserving your bankroll longer. Conversely, higher RTP slots (96%+) improve your long-term return potential. Always check these numbers before playing; they determine your real chances, not superstition or luck. Choosing games with a 99% RTP and 1% house edge maximizes your odds of walking away with cash.
